Commentary


Dans la base TSP maintenue par Michel Prieur, quatre exemplaires seulement sont maintenant répertoriés. À noter que le seul musée qui en ait un exemplaire, Paris, ne l’a acquis qu’en 1990.
In the TSP database maintained by Michel Prieur, only four examples are now listed. Note that the only museum which has a example, Paris, only acquired it in 1990

Historical background


GALBA

(2/04/68-15/01/69)

Galba was born on December 24, 3 BC. He was raised by Livia and quickly rose through the ranks of the Roman administration. Praetor under Tiberius at the age of 20, he was consul in 33, then legate of Germania Superior at the beginning of the reign of Caligula. He is proconsul of Africa in 42 after having won a great victory over the Cats the previous year by covering the signs of Varus. Nero appoints him governor of Spain Tarraconaise. It was there that he went into rebellion against Nero in April 68. After the crushing of the revolt of Vindex in Gaul in May, Nero committed suicide on June 9. Galba was proclaimed august on June 11. He is slowly gaining Rome. Avaricious, he governs clumsily. He adopted Pison on January 10, 69 instead of choosing Otho. During this time Vitellius was proclaimed august on January 1, 69 by the legions of Germania. Abandoned by everyone, Galba was finally assassinated on January 15..
